Finance Review Summary — Large-Deal Discount Policy

This quarter, discounts on deals above the Merrow threshold averaged 21%, exceeding the 15% policy ceiling in 40% of cases. Margin erosion totalled roughly 3 points across the Caldana portfolio. Finance recommends tightening approval authority and requiring CFO sign-off above 18%. The revised policy takes effect next quarter. The board should consider the following before ratification.

board note of kagep-yahig: Only 9 of the 120 pilot accounts renewed Quenix, so a churn review is set for April 1.

## Onboarding: Invoicepress Renderer Plugins

The Invoicepress renderer converts billing records into archival PDFs. Plugins may register custom page layouts and locale-aware number formats, but may not touch the totals pipeline. Submissions run in a sandboxed render pass before approval, and every plugin bundle must carry a valid signature. Sign your first submission using the key below.

rollout seal: bky13_Mi5bKzEWhnsFq

Runbook §4.2 — Retrying failed exports (Cartwheel Analytics). Before requeueing, verify the export job failed with a transient error code, confirm no partial file exists in the staging bucket, and log the retry in the audit channel. Retries beyond three require lead approval. The retry submission must be signed; use the export-retry signing key shown below.

release key, hadug-kawef: bky13_mPGeFZeR1GZ1G